e1000e hardware supports a single RX/TX queue pair, add basic support
for ethtool -l (i.e. get_channels), so that callers indeed see a single
queue.

+/**
+ * e1000e_get_channels - Report number of network channels
+ * @netdev: network interface device structure
+ * @ch: ethtool channels structure
+ *
+ * e1000e hardware supports a single RX/TX queue pair. When MSI-X is
+ * in use, an additional vector is dedicated to link/status ("other")
+ * events.
+ **/
+static void e1000e_get_channels(struct net_device *netdev,
+                               struct ethtool_channels *ch)
+{
+       struct e1000_adapter *adapter = netdev_priv(netdev);
+
+       /* single combined RX/TX channel */
+       ch->max_combined = 1;
+       ch->combined_count = 1;
+
+       /* report "other" vector when MSI-X is in use */
+       if (adapter->msix_entries) {
+               ch->max_other = 1;
+               ch->other_count = 1;
+       }
+}
